The editors liked
Pros
Funky looks meet functional controls
Competitive noise cancelling and dynamic sound
Comfortable and with enough battery for all-day listening
The editors didn't like
Cons
Some features restricted to Nothing smartphones
You'll either love or hate the styling
Can't match (pricier) class leaders on audio or ANC

Abstract: Nothing mostly gets eyes for its smartphones at this point, but it's audio that put this brand on the map. Over time, Nothing has built up a reputation for delivering excellent value in its audio products and rock solid sound quality at the same time. The...
Clever transparently designed headphones,They make you stand out with an 80s tape deck vibe,Better sound than expected,Surprisingly capable noise cancellation,USB-C audio support,Head tracked spatial is here
Head-tracked spatial audio isn't fantastic,Earpads aren't easily removable,They don't fold up (even though they fold flat),Controls are sometimes too easy to use incorrectly
